Kovács, Gábor M., María P. Martín & Francisco D. Calonge. First record of Mattirolomyces terfezioides from the Iberian Peninsula: its southern- and westernmost locality. Mycotaxon 110: 325–330. 2009. ABSTRACT: During revision of Terfezia specimens in the Mycological Collection of the Herbarium of the Real Jardín Botánico of Madrid (MA-Fungi), morphological and molecular analyses revealed a specimen collected in Madrid as the truffle Mattirolomyces terfezioides. This paper presents the first record of the species from the Iberian Peninsula, the western- and southernmost known locality for M. terfezioides in Europe. General characteristics of known collection sites are also discussed. KEYWORDS: Pezizaceae, Hydnobolites, biogeography, host plant, ITS |
